Securely Connect Remote IoT P2P Raspberry Pi Download Windows Free: A Comprehensive Guide
Connecting remote IoT devices with peer-to-peer (P2P) networking on a Raspberry Pi while ensuring security is no longer a distant dream. Whether you're a tech enthusiast, hobbyist, or professional developer, this guide will walk you through the process step by step. Securely connect remote IoT P2P Raspberry Pi and download the necessary tools for free on Windows to get started today!
Imagine being able to control your home automation system from anywhere in the world without worrying about security breaches. With advancements in IoT technology, this level of convenience is now achievable. However, setting up a secure connection between your devices can be tricky if you don’t know where to start.
This article aims to demystify the process of securely connecting remote IoT P2P Raspberry Pi devices while also providing resources for downloading the essential tools for free on Windows. Stick around as we dive into the nitty-gritty details to help you master this setup!
Table of Contents
- Introduction
- Understanding IoT and Its Importance
- Raspberry Pi: The Heart of Your IoT Setup
- How to Securely Connect Remote IoT Devices
- Peer-to-Peer (P2P) Networking Explained
- Tools Required for Setting Up Secure Connections
- Downloading Necessary Tools for Free on Windows
- Step-by-Step Setup Guide
- Common Issues and Troubleshooting Tips
- Best Practices for Secure IoT Connections
- Conclusion
Introduction
IoT, or the Internet of Things, has revolutionized the way we interact with technology. It allows everyday devices to communicate and share data seamlessly, creating a smarter and more connected world. But with great power comes great responsibility. Ensuring the security of these connections is crucial, especially when dealing with remote devices.
Raspberry Pi, a small yet powerful single-board computer, plays a pivotal role in IoT setups. Its versatility and affordability make it an ideal choice for both beginners and experts alike. By securely connecting remote IoT P2P Raspberry Pi devices, you can unlock endless possibilities for automation and remote control.
Understanding IoT and Its Importance
IoT refers to the network of physical objects embedded with sensors, software, and connectivity, enabling them to exchange data. These devices range from smart home appliances to industrial machinery. The importance of IoT lies in its ability to enhance efficiency, reduce costs, and improve overall user experience.
Benefits of IoT
- Increased automation and efficiency
- Real-time monitoring and data analysis
- Cost savings through optimized resource usage
- Enhanced user experience with smart devices
Raspberry Pi: The Heart of Your IoT Setup
Raspberry Pi is a popular choice for IoT projects due to its compact size, low cost, and high performance. It supports a wide range of operating systems and programming languages, making it highly customizable for various applications.
Key Features of Raspberry Pi
- Powerful ARM-based processor
- Multiple GPIO pins for interfacing with sensors and actuators
- Support for various operating systems, including Linux and Windows IoT
- Compatibility with numerous accessories and add-ons
How to Securely Connect Remote IoT Devices
Securing your IoT devices is paramount to protect sensitive data and prevent unauthorized access. Here are some steps to ensure a secure connection:
Encryption
Use encryption protocols such as TLS (Transport Layer Security) to secure data transmitted between devices. This ensures that even if the data is intercepted, it remains unreadable to unauthorized parties.
Firewall Configuration
Set up a firewall on your Raspberry Pi to restrict incoming and outgoing traffic. This adds an extra layer of security by blocking unauthorized access attempts.
User Authentication
Implement strong user authentication mechanisms, such as two-factor authentication (2FA), to verify the identity of users accessing your devices.
Peer-to-Peer (P2P) Networking Explained
Peer-to-peer (P2P) networking allows devices to communicate directly with each other without the need for a central server. This reduces latency and improves efficiency, making it ideal for IoT applications.
Advantages of P2P Networking
- Reduced reliance on centralized servers
- Lower latency and faster communication
- Improved scalability and flexibility
Tools Required for Setting Up Secure Connections
To securely connect remote IoT P2P Raspberry Pi devices, you’ll need the following tools:
- Raspberry Pi board
- Power supply and microSD card
- Operating system (e.g., Raspbian or Windows IoT)
- Network cables or Wi-Fi adapter
- SSH client for remote access
Downloading Necessary Tools for Free on Windows
Getting started with your Raspberry Pi project doesn’t have to break the bank. You can download all the necessary tools for free on Windows. Here’s how:
Step 1: Download Raspbian OS
Visit the official Raspberry Pi website and download the latest version of Raspbian, a Debian-based operating system optimized for Raspberry Pi.
Step 2: Install Etcher
Etcher is a free and easy-to-use tool for writing the Raspbian image to your microSD card. Simply download and install it on your Windows PC.
Step 3: Set Up SSH
Enable SSH on your Raspberry Pi by creating an empty file named "ssh" on the boot partition of the microSD card. This allows you to remotely access your Pi from your Windows PC.
Step-by-Step Setup Guide
Now that you have all the tools, let’s walk through the setup process:
Step 1: Install the Operating System
Use Etcher to write the Raspbian image to your microSD card. Insert the card into your Raspberry Pi and power it on.
Step 2: Configure Network Settings
Set up your Pi to connect to your Wi-Fi network by editing the wpa_supplicant.conf file on the boot partition. Include your network SSID and password.
Step 3: Access Your Pi Remotely
Use an SSH client like PuTTY to connect to your Raspberry Pi from your Windows PC. Enter the Pi’s IP address and log in with the default credentials (username: pi, password: raspberry).
Common Issues and Troubleshooting Tips
Even with the best-laid plans, things can go wrong. Here are some common issues and how to fix them:
Issue 1: Unable to Connect to Wi-Fi
Double-check your wpa_supplicant.conf file for typos. Ensure your network SSID and password are correct.
Issue 2: SSH Not Working
Verify that the "ssh" file exists on the boot partition. Restart your Raspberry Pi and try again.
Best Practices for Secure IoT Connections
Here are some best practices to keep your IoT devices secure:
- Regularly update your operating system and software
- Use strong, unique passwords for all devices
- Monitor network traffic for suspicious activity
- Limit access to sensitive data and functions
Conclusion
Securing remote IoT P2P Raspberry Pi connections may seem daunting at first, but with the right tools and knowledge, it’s entirely achievable. By following the steps outlined in this guide, you can set up a secure and efficient IoT network that enhances your daily life.
Don’t hesitate to leave a comment below if you have any questions or need further clarification. And remember, sharing is caring – feel free to share this article with your fellow tech enthusiasts!
Stay safe, stay connected, and happy tinkering!
Sone 303-018: Unlocking The Secrets Of This Revolutionary Tech Device
Teenxy: The Ultimate Guide To Understanding The Trend, Culture, And Everything In Between
Salt Under The Tongue: The Surprising Truth Behind This Age-Old Practice

Securely Connect Remote IoT VPC Raspberry Pi Free Download For Windows

Securely Connect Remote IoT P2P Raspberry Pi Download Windows A

Securely Connect Remote IoT P2P Raspberry Pi Download Windows A